Busana - Khanpur St, Sonipat

Busana is a village situated in the Khanpur St tehsil of Sonipat district, Haryana. It is located approximately 16 km from Gohana and around 55 km from Sonipat. Busana village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Busana is 059629. The village covers a total geographical area of 932 hectares and falls under the 131306 pincode. Gohana is the nearest town.

Busana village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Baroda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Sonipat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Busana

According to the 2011 Census, Busana village had a total population of 3,771 people, including 2,042 males and 1,729 females, living in 700 households. The sex ratio was 847 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 76.48%, with male literacy at 84.13% and female literacy at 67.65%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 557.
